I must be honest.
today, as with other days, when i look at some of the shops in and around the Harwich / Dovercourt area, it also is in dire need of money being spent in it to regenerate the shopping areas in its High Streets..
Those who know of my passion for regeneration of my village area, know that money is so badly needed, but just where do you start.
In my village, the community is split on how it should be done, with some residents just not wanting anything done at all.
In Councillor David Lines Budget Speech in the Town hall, he says regeneration is not if, but when.
In the Harwich and local area, it is the same.....
The main driver for regeneration would be a massive increase in Jobs.
+++++ JOBS MEAN PROSPERITY+++++++++++++++++
How long has the Haven gateway been going, how long to wait and see,
how much longer do the suffering residents of our communities have to look at boarded up shops in its High streets, in its communities, its empty factories.....
I read somewhere (Housing and Regeneration Bill) that a sum of 2,300 MILLION is set aside for the
H C A (Homes and Communities Agency)
Its objectives of the H C A are:-
to improve the supply and quality of housing in England, among other things...
I realise this new Bill has yet to gain momentum, but as MP Barbara Follet is the Champion for regeneration, and East Of England one at that, its about time she came down from Peterborough and have a good look at our communities in the coastal villages and towns in Tendring.........
